Understanding Boat & Watercraft Insurance in Dickinson

Boat insurance in Dickinson must address local factors like saltwater exposure from Galveston Bay, hurricane risk every summer, and high humidity that can accelerate wear and tear. Our team at The O'Donohoe Agency tailors policies for various craft—bass boats, jet skis, and pontoons—adjusting coverage based on where you dock or store your boat, especially if you’re near Dickinson High School or the residential areas along Hughes Road. Liability, hull coverage, and protections for equipment are all essential, given the area’s boating popularity and unpredictable coastal weather.

Local Dickinson Factors That Affect Your Boat Insurance Rates

Dickinson’s blend of bayou-front neighborhoods like Bay Colony and the well-traveled FM 517 corridor means insurance rates can vary block by block. Homes and marinas close to the water, especially along Dickinson Bayou and Deats Road, often face higher premiums due to increased flood and windstorm risk. The city’s location between Houston and Galveston also means more traffic on weekends, raising accident risks at popular launch points. Crime rates tend to be lower in Dickinson than in nearby urban centers, but boaters in more secluded subdivisions like Bentwood or Colonial Estates may still benefit from enhanced theft protection. Does hurricane season affect my boat insurance in Dickinson?

Yes. Dickinson's proximity to Galveston Bay means hurricane season can bring increased risk of wind and water damage. We recommend reviewing your policy each spring to ensure you have comprehensive coverage, especially if your boat is stored near flood-prone areas like Deats Road or the bayou-front neighborhoods.

How are boat insurance rates calculated for Dickinson residents?

Rates in Dickinson factor in your proximity to water, flood zones, neighborhood crime rates, and even how and where you store your boat. Properties south of FM 517 or closer to the bayou may see higher premiums, while secure storage options can help lower your costs.
